Frequently Asked Questions about East Downtown

How much are Studio apartments in East Downtown?

There are currently 15 Studio Apartments in East Downtown with rent ranges from $1,295 to $2,334 with an average price of $1,617.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om East Downtown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in East Downtown ranges from $895 to $3,189 with an average monthly rent of $1,808.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in East Downtown c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in East Downtown range from $1,129 to $4,116.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,156.

How expensive are East Downtown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 19 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in East Downtown on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,459 to $3,097 - averaging $2,362 for the location.
